Kath Lane – Clinical Director

Grad Dip Phys MCSP HCPC

Kath Lane Qualified from Pinderfields college of physiotherapy in 1992 with a Grad Dip Phys MCSP and started work at the Royal Berkshire Hospital. I continued working there specialising in Orthopaedics, rheumatology and musculoskeletal outpatients.

 

In 1996 I started work at the Police Rehabilitation Centre, again specialising in musculoskeletal conditions and rehabilitation. Then in 1998 I set up Wallingford Physiotherapy Practice which later expanded to include Martha Venner and Ian Barron, who are both very experienced musculoskeletal therapists. I then went on to develop rehabilitation services with Nathan Clayton, a sports and Rehabilitation therapist.

 

The Practice has gone from strength to strength and now offers physiotherapy most days including Saturdays, and now offers Hydrotherapy, a special interest of mine. I am also very interested in Rheumatology, chronic pain and Orthopaedic rehabilitation.
